The Arts NC State Creative Artist Award recognizes original work in music, dance and theatre created by NC State students. Each winning creative artist(s) receives $500, and the selected work(s) will be performed in the following academic year by the appropriateArts NC State performing arts program. Come join us at Imurj, a collaborative art and music space in downtown Raleigh. This is an interactive workshop that will introduce the basics of mixing, Serato functions, history, and other fundamentals to the art of DJing. Participants will have the opportunity to play with Pioneer DJ Controllers as well as vinyl. This workshop is intended as an introduction, but open to individuals of all skill sets.
